Polyphony Digital has released a new update for their Gran Turismo 6 Playstation 3 racer.
Aside from several small changes listed below, the 2.1 GB update introduces two brand new “Vision Gran Turismo” cars from Aston Martin & Nissan.
These fictional concept cars have become a popular trend in the Gran Turismo world as several manufactures have now designed concept cars for the title.
The two newest ones can be seen below, while the Aston Martin comes with a 800hp V12 engine, the Nissan uses a V6 bi-turbo hybrid setup with no less than three electrical motors.
Brake Caliper Paint
It is now possible to repaint the brake calipers on cars equipped with [Racing Brakes] purchased within the [Suspension] menu of [Tuning Parts]. Please note there are certain cars that cannot be repainted using this feature.
More Car Number Customization Options
More cars have been made compatible with the [Driver Number] feature in the [Garage]. There is also an increased selection of [Base] sheet designs on which the numbers can be displayed.
Engine brake reduction control on formula cars disabled
Engine brake reduction control that was active on certain formula cars has been disabled. This is a feature that helps you avoid spinning out from excessive braking forces generated by the engine while the throttle is in the off position. This was accomplished by slightly opening the throttle while cornering even with no input to the accelerator.
